Laripur® 2102-85AE is a thermoplastic polyurethane (TPU) based on polycaprolactone ester. The standard version is specifically formulated for injection molding applications, making it suitable for the production of technical items such as watch belts, bellows, and seals. Additionally, there is another version tailored for extrusion processes, such as the production of hoses, profiles, transmission belts, and films. This indicates its versatility in catering to different manufacturing needs within the plastics industry.

Processing Recommendations

Material needs to be dried prior processing at 175-195 °F for 3 hours, preferably using a dehumidifying drier fed by air exhibiting a dew point lower than -22°F.

Suggested molding temperature profile

Zone Temperature
Zone 1 355°F
Zone 2 365°F
Zone 3 375°F
Nozzle 365°F


Suggested extrusion temperature profile

Zone Temperature
Zone 1 375°F
Zone 2 380°F
Zone 3 390°F
Zone 4 385°F
Adapter 375°F
Die 365°F

Being affected by type of machine used, processing conditions and downstream equipment, the temperature profiles as given above has to be considered as just indicative.

 

Properties

Physical Form
Physico-Chemical Properties
ValueUnitsTest Method / Conditions
Tensile Strength9300psiASTM D412
Vicat Softening Point192°FASTM D1525
Tensile Modulus (at 50%)610psiASTM D412
Tensile Modulus (at 300%)2500psiASTM D412
Tensile Modulus (at 100%)890psiASTM D412
Tear Strength72N/mmASTM D624
Specific Gravity1.16g/cm³ASTM D792
Shore Hardness84A ScaleASTM D2240
Abrasion Loss30mm³DIN 53516
Elongation (at Break)510%ASTM D412

Packaging Information

Laripur® 2102-85AE is supplied in regular pellet form and it is packaged in 25 kg bags or 500 kg and 1000 kg octabins

Storage & Handling

Shelf Life
6 months
Storage and Shelf Life Conditions
  • Laripur® 2102-85AE must be stored in its original and sealed containers and kept in a dry and well ventilated place; avoiding the direct sun radiation.
  • The shelf life of Laripur® 2102-85AE will be 6 months from the date of delivery to the final customer, when stored in its original sealed packaging and in proper conditions.
